/**
|
|
* The Horde_Auth_Pam:: class provides a PAM-based implementation of the Horde
|
|
* authentication system.
|
|
*
|
|
* PAM (Pluggable Authentication Modules) is a flexible mechanism for
|
|
* authenticating users. It has become the standard authentication system for
|
|
* Linux, Solaris and FreeBSD.
|
|
*
|
|
* This driver relies on the PECL PAM package:
|
|
*
|
|
* http://pecl.php.net/package/PAM
